Priests of Sera should have spells which continue along the Guidance track.
Spells that improve the Craft or Profession checks of a single person by a
lot, or a moderate amount for a group. Speed of craftsmanship could be
improved, like Haste, but only as it effects a Craft or Profession skill,
not combat.

No doubt Laerme has similar spells for Perfom skill checks. Or, depending
on how you handle skills, for Craft checks related only to beauty or art,
not functionality.

Craftsman
Divination
Level: Clr 1 (Sera or Laerme)
Componants: V, S, DF
Casting Time: 1 round
Range: Touch
Target: Creature Touched
Duration: special
Saving Throw: Will negates (harmless)
Spell Resistance: Yes (harmless)

This spell imbues the subject with a minor inspiration of divine guidance.
The creature gets a +5 competence bonus on a single Craft, Profession, or
Performance check named by the caster during the spellcasting. Only Sera`s
guidance improves the quality of Craft or Profession results. Only Laerme
improves the beauty of Craft or Performance checks. The subject of the
spell must begin work on the task in the subsequent round or the inspiration
is lost. The spell lasts as long as the creature labors on a single task
for which there is a skill check. The task must be performable within one
day.

Then at 3rd, 5th, 7th, and 9th levels, improved versions of the spell could
be possible which give some of the following benefits: greater bonus or more
people effected. The 3rd level version might give one person a +10
competance bonus, or 1d4+1 people each a +5 bonus. At 5th level, the spell
could grant Haste like effects, but only for Craft, Profession, or Perform
checks. The craftsman would produce 50% more silver pieces worth of item
(or copper if measured by day) while working on a single labor. 7th level
might have two spells. One gives a single person a +15 competance bonus, or
2d6 people a +5 bonus. The other might allow two people to combine efforts,
so that the second person adds half their their skill ranks to another
person, and 50% more silver peices (or CP) are produced per week (or day).
At 9th level, perhaps you can give one person a +20 competance bonus, or
give 5d4 people a +5 bonus.
